World Youth 2012 to Thailand

22nd August, Munich: WTBA President, Mr Kevin Dornberger announced during the farewell banquet of the World Men's Championships 2010 at Unterföhring near Munich that the World Youth Championships 2012 will be held in Bangkok, Thailand.

The championships period will be from June 22 to July 3, 2012 at the Blu-O Paragon Bowling Center in Bangkok. Thailand had previously hosted the 2002 World Youth Championships in Patayya and the 2008 World Men's Championships in Bangkok. The country has also hosted several South East Asian Games and the 1998 Asian Games.

Korea sweeps Masters titles
1st August, Helsinki: Korea swept the Masters titles of the World Youth Championsip 2010 as Kim Yeon-Ju made a great comeback to win the Girl's title while Kim Ju-Young defeated team-mate Shin Seung-Hyeon to claim the Boy's crown.
Korea celebrates Team double
31st July, Helsinki: Korea underlined their dominance to celebrate a Team double by winning the Boy's and Girl's Team gold medals of the World Youth Championship 2010 at Tali Bowl on Saturday.
American boys dominate doubles
28th July, Helsinki: Junior Team USA dominated the Boy's Doubles finals of the World Youth Championship 2010 by earning the gold and silver medals at Tali Bowl on Wednesday with Korea and Malaysia sharing for the bronze.
Asbaty claims 2012 Queens title
Diandra Asbaty of Chicago, defeated USBC Hall of Famer Carolyn Dorin-Ballard of Keller, Texas, 244-227, to win her first career major title at the 2012 USBC Queens.
Consecutive title for Finn
Osku Palermaa took his second consecutive title with victory in the 9th Kuwait International Open and the 6th stop of the WTBA World Bowling Tour.
Korean rolls 3 consecutive 300
Asian Youth four gold medalist, Choi Tae-Seung set a new Korean record after rolling three consecutive perfect games during the Korean National Youth team selections.
